WebCan a snake go straight up a wall? The answer is that yes, some species of snake are excellent climbers, and can climb walls. But not just any wall. The snake must have something to grab ahold of and push off of. Not even a rough surface will do - snakes can't "stick" to walls the way insects, rats. WebJan 18, 2024 · Snakes can enter a house through small openings, such as gaps around windows and doors, or through holes in the foundation. If they find an opening in the wall, they can go inside and take up residence there. Snakes can survive in small spaces, such as walls since they can flatten their body and make their way through tight spaces. WebMar 23, 2024 · Prune your trees and shrubs so the ground is visible and there are no shady areas for snoozing snakes. Keep your grass short. Avoid wood or rock piles — snakes love to slink inside and hide in the cool. Locate ponds away from the house because some snakes are attracted to water.
